![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
日常比赛
文章平均质量分 67
Kernight
骨灰级程序员。
展开
-
Google Code Jam 2014 B. Cookie Clicker Alpha
#include#include#includeusing namespace std;#define N 5double c, f, x, s;int judge(){ double temp = (c/s) + (x/(s+f)); if(x/s > temp) return 1; else return 0;}int原创 2014-04-12 10:50:26 · 801 阅读 · 0 评论 -
HDU 1239 Calling Extraterrestrial Intelligence Again
HDU 1239Calling Extraterrestrial Intelligence Again题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1239题目大意:两个素数 p, q 并且 p*q 4 求最大的q,p值有上面可以得出,判断的过程并不难,把100000以内素数全部求出,然后两两判断就行了。但是,原创 2015-11-07 21:24:33 · 630 阅读 · 0 评论 -
HDU 2133 What day is it
HDU 2133What day is it题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2133题目大意:给出一个日期。求这个日期是星期几?如果日期格式非法,则输出 ”illegal“ 。 有一个公式叫蔡勒公式,但是运算结果有差错,我不知道是不是我计算有问题,这里不做讨论。另外一种暴力的方法就是计算出该日期距离00原创 2015-11-07 21:21:17 · 561 阅读 · 0 评论 -
HDU 2600 War
HDU 2600 War题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2600题目大意:给出一个初始区间和n个覆盖区间。如果所有的覆盖区间不能全部覆盖初始区间,则输出区间上没有被覆盖的最大的点。如果初始区间被完全覆盖,则输出 “Badly!”。 典型的贪心,区间覆盖四个字都写到脸上了。对于所有的覆盖区间[Ai,Bi原创 2015-11-07 21:17:52 · 531 阅读 · 0 评论 -
HDU 1176 免费馅饼
HDU 1176免费馅饼题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1176这道题是二维动态规划,有两个需要考虑的变量:时间T,位置P。由题意可得,我们需要求出的最终结果是:在最终时间T_max时,位置从0到10中得到馅饼数量最多的数量。这里涉及到一个问题,时间T和位置P,应该先求哪个的值?也就是说,在循环规划的过程中,有这两种原创 2015-11-07 21:10:36 · 522 阅读 · 0 评论 -
HDU 1396 Counting Triangles
Problem DescriptionGiven an equilateral triangle with n the length of its side, program to count how many triangles in it. InputThe length n (n process to the end of th转载 2014-07-10 17:50:28 · 551 阅读 · 0 评论 -
HDU 2068 RPG的错排
Problem Description今年暑假杭电ACM集训队第一次组成女生队,其中有一队叫RPG,但做为集训队成员之一的野骆驼竟然不知道RPG三个人具体是谁谁。RPG给他机会让他猜猜,第一次猜:R是公主,P是草儿,G是月野兔;第二次猜:R是草儿,P是月野兔,G是公主;第三次猜:R是草儿,P是公主,G是月野兔;......可怜的野骆驼第六次终于把RPG分清楚了。由于RPG的带动,做ACM的女生原创 2014-07-10 17:30:21 · 657 阅读 · 0 评论 -
ZOJ 1012 Mainframe
一道模拟题 题意待会解答:#include #include #include #include #include using namespace std;typedef long long LL;#define INF 0x7fffffff#define MOD 10000007#define M 10005#define N 105#define WA原创 2014-07-19 16:50:00 · 766 阅读 · 0 评论 -
Google Code Jam 2014 A. Magic Trick
#include#includeusing namespace std;#define N 5int judge(int f[N][N],int o,int s[N][N],int t,int* a){ int pos = -1; for(int i = 1; i < N; i++) for(int j = 1; j < N; j++)原创 2014-04-12 10:25:49 · 671 阅读 · 0 评论 -
HDU NO.3548 Enumerate the Triangles
题目大意: 给定1000个点,求围成三角形的最大周长。解题思路: 先把边保存下来,减小后面不必要的复杂度,之后有三个循环1000^3,会超时,有个重要的剪枝,就是在第二个循环里面如果这两个点的长度的两倍大于等于最小周长,那么这个解不是最优,直接减掉,注意,这个剪枝非常重要。是解决这道问题的关键所在。解题感想:原创 2014-04-12 20:28:26 · 674 阅读 · 0 评论 -
博客迁移到 https://blog.kernight.com
博客迁移到 http://blog.ykgzs.com弄了好几天,终于把主机搞定了。原来有一个博客,自从自己开始做web开发之后,就觉得应该有一个自己独立的主机,这样子做的demo就能很直接的呈现出来,而且平时做一些开发也能消除局限性了。不管怎么说,也算一个新的开始,继续加油吧。访问:http://blog.ykgzs.com 是我的博客原创 2015-12-05 23:04:34 · 1394 阅读 · 0 评论